The Treasury launched www.makinghomeaffordable.gov to help homeowners see if they would be eligible for the new Making Home Affordable Program. The Site is meant for homeowners seeking information about loan modification and loan refinancing who are still questioning if they will ever be able to make their mortgage payments affordable again.
